**Alert: Suspicious package match — Lintrap Scanner**

Lintrap flagged a newly published package whose name closely resembles a popular internal dependency, with edit distance below the alert threshold. The package is quarantined automatically; no customer builds pulled it. Support should reassure affected teams and avoid naming the package publicly. Triage steps and the quarantine review queue are on the internal page here.

runbook for badug-kadup: https://confluence.zemvarlabs.internal/projects/browse/display/projects/bd1b

**Q: What are the building hours over the holiday period?**

During the Wintermere closure (24 December to 2 January), the Larkspur Wing operates on reduced access. Night shift staff should note that the main entrance locks at 20:00 rather than 22:00, and the south lobby is closed entirely. Security patrols run hourly instead of half-hourly, so plan fire-door checks accordingly. Enter and exit only via the north door during this period, and sign the night register on every shift. The north door requires the holiday access code below.

door code, kawip-bagap: bdg-HQEWH-4

Subject: Scheduled key rotation for the Quotaforge tenant service

Hello, and welcome aboard. As part of our quarterly rotation, the credential used by the Quotaforge service — which enforces per-tenant rate quotas across all Bellhollow environments — will be replaced this Thursday at 09:00. The old key stops working immediately after cutover, so update any local configs you maintain before then. To avoid disruption, the replacement key is provided below.

gateway credential: kto7_GoY89Me

Shuttle-bus gate (Onboarding, Section 4). The Fennick Campus shuttle departs from Gate C every twenty minutes between 07:00 and 19:00. Team assistants booking seats for new starters should note that the gate is badge-controlled on both sides, so a starter without an activated badge cannot return to the main building unescorted. Always confirm badge activation with Facilities before the first shuttle trip. If a starter must travel before activation is complete, they may use the interim gate code listed below.

door code, yagap-bahof: bdg-O-05